At the German Linguistics Olympiad (DOL), students put their linguistic intuition, cultural imagination, and logical-analytical thinking to the test. The tasks are based on datasets from natural and artificial languages and invite participants to identify and apply systematic patterns in grammar, writing systems, sounds, numeral systems, or other areas of language.
The first round of DOL 2026 will take place online from 12 January to 1 February 2026. Eligible to participate are students who are enrolled at a school in Germany, are at least 14 years old, and have not yet reached the age of 20 on the first day of the International Linguistics Olympiad (26 July 2026). Participation is free of charge.
The best participants of the second round will be invited to the final round, including training, in Berlin. Particularly successful participants qualify for the International Linguistics Olympiad (IOL), which will take place from 26 July to 2 August 2026 in Bucharest (Romania).
